John Mushayavanhu is a Zimbabwean central bank governor and former FBC Holdings Limited CEO. In 1997, Mushayavanhu joined FBC Bank as an executive director in the corporate banking division. In March 2024, he was appointed Governor of the Reserve Bank of Zimbabwe by President Emmerson Mnangagwa to replace John Mangudya.
